Tutors delivering education for a national workforce development company have been equipped with a special safety device to protect them whilst working alone.

edudo, which provides tailored work-led education courses, is using the state-of-the-art MySOS device to protect lone working staff in need of urgent support when faced with a learner who is displaying emotional, unpredictable or challenging behaviour. 

The wearable device enables staff to alert colleagues to issues, or in extreme cases can send an SOS alert to a specialist monitoring centre operated by Skyguard, which is able to offer support or call in the emergency services.

edudo MD Ronan Smith said: “The eduguard alert system allows me to sleep a little easier, knowing that if one of our tutors or support staff needs assistance, professional support is only the touch of a button away.”
